Output d6e2585f96adc5eaa29d6f868fd2e4858f63d714305787f00a607285669c54b9:1

value
179692151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a2c2c647f4a3bc3863734632a6dcb0ae11d3abe OP_EQUAL
address
3FkCuJouxPh29ontGuXXCSFkJvcaUQbkjP
transaction
d6e2585f96adc5eaa29d6f868fd2e4858f63d714305787f00a607285669c54b9
confirmations
150798
spent
true